- Lead the development and execution of the annual business plan.
- Provide challenge and assurance to the Business Plan preparation, overseeing financial modelling of the plan to support scenario planning, resource allocation and growth objectives.
- Deliver Executive reports with key insights, recommendations and updates to senior stakeholders
Job Responsibilities
- Lead the development of short- and longer-term strategic business plans and specifically the development of the annual 5-year Business Plan.
- Ensure the Business Plan is aligned with the strategy and the vision of the organization.
- Ensure Plans are deliverable via appropriate target setting / assurance. Identify risks. Provide challenges.
- Monitor external global trends to have an in-depth understanding of what is happening in the industry in so far as they impact the strategy
- Play an active role to support the company's BUs in developing their strategies.
- Develop scenario models to help determine the impact of certain changes or risks that face the organization
- Ensure alignment between the business plan, financial plans and operations
- Oversee and manage the company's portfolio of upstream (exploration & production).
- Assess new business opportunities, including potential markets, emerging technologies, and strategic partnerships.
- Test robustness of current portfolio, business models and capabilities to deliver the strategy.
- Forecast oil prices, supply-demand balances, and geopolitical risks to inform the company's short- and long-term business strategies.
- Maintain up-to-date economic model for DO portfolio and provide coherent economic analysis accordingly.
- Review Integrated Field Development Plans in respect of assets, projects or activities to ensure alignment of the technical options with strategy and to ensure a strong and robust business case.
- Identify potential resource bottlenecks, unique requirements, contingencies and plan accordingly.
Education
- Bachelor's degree in Business or Finance
- Minimum 12 years' experience in developing and executing business plans in energy sector, commercial finance, monitoring scorecards to track progress and identify gaps
